If you're looking for a beautiful atmospheric experience, this is the game for you. You play as a warrior with a sword you use to surf through the terrain to ultimately restore the ocean. It tells it's story mostly through steles you can find out in the world and you can go through the game without interacting with them or paying any attention to the narrative. It has a similar feel to games like [Sky: Children of the Light] and [Journey] and while there isn't much in the way of difficulty there's a variety of collectibles out in the world to find. It also includes a photo mode which and this is always a plus for me when games include it. My major gripe with the game was that although you can perform aerial tricks on the board and the game keeps track of a score for each trick, there isn't much variety to them and after a couple of hours I got bored of them and mostly interacted with it for the "Great Score" achievement.
